Transaction 44af436cc9513c75841a3c6ab48567412b7cfa55b7138ade7329e792f7782a41
4 Input
2 Outputs
- 44af436cc9513c75841a3c6ab48567412b7cfa55b7138ade7329e792f7782a41:0
- 44af436cc9513c75841a3c6ab48567412b7cfa55b7138ade7329e792f7782a41:1
value 444820
address 3JJ5tcpaC9NA7BmUybwjstv5mjpauB7RNe
value 80565
address 114PWrPFE8kMyrXW3jYFMZM83f7RC2Y7zb